AI-generated source summary
The analysis begins with Bitcoin at $105,384, forecasting a potential price discovery up to $138,788 and highlights a fail bound at around $75,684. The analyst points out the shift from extreme fear to comfortable greed in the market and mentions articles suggesting higher price targets, such as $200K to $250K for Bitcoin in 2025 due to supply crunch and institutional adoption. The discussion touches on reclaiming range low, targeting range mid, and aiming for range high at $109,000. It cautions that we are almost 2.5 years into a bull market, indicating that Bitcoin is a very momentum-driven asset. The discussion then shifts to Ethereum, now at $2737, with a target of $4000, identifying $2000 as a fail bound. The presenter believes Ethereum can reach $4000 if it can pass the resistance at around $2800, pointing towards a true capitulation at lower levels. Solana's outlook is also solid, with the target being $280, with a fail bound at $122.
